Lionel Messi and Co. Lead the Way in MLS as Midseason Break Approaches
The Major League Soccer (MLS) season is well underway, with teams vying for the top spot in the league. While perennial favorites like Lionel Messi’s team remain at the forefront, there have been some surprising starts from teams like Nashville, San Jose, and Vancouver, making the league all the more exciting as it heads into a long break.
With the World Cup approaching, MLS will be taking a much-needed six-week break to allow players to rest and recuperate. This break comes at the midway point of the season, with teams having played around 15 games each. It’s a chance for players to recharge and reset before the remainder of the season.
Contender Analysis
As teams assess their performance in the first half of the season, some patterns are emerging. Inter Miami, led by their star player, are once again proving to be top contenders. Nashville SC has also shown strong performances, indicating they are a force to be reckoned with. The Seattle Sounders, a perennial playoff team, are once again on track to make a postseason appearance.
However, there have been some surprises in the league as well. The San Jose Earthquakes have proven themselves to be a legitimate threat, while the Chicago Fire have impressed with their style of play. LAFC, in the midst of a transition period post-Steve Cherundolo, are working to find their footing.
